Transaction 5b7caaf38d4633a9de3512219a7038929cb6a00c834d564609d49f8870e97f30
1 Input
1 Output
-
5b7caaf38d4633a9de3512219a7038929cb6a00c834d564609d49f8870e97f30:0
- value
- 638482
- script pubkey
- OP_0 OP_PUSHBYTES_20 b98ecc4e40e8cc64dc60e169f4471652812fe423
- address
- bc1qhx8vcnjqarxxfhrqu95lg3ck22qjleprqknw4z